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Start working on doc for udev rule on non systemd linux #1094

Merged
merged 3 commits into from
Dec 2, 2022

Conversation

bobsaintcool
Copy link
Contributor

@bobsaintcool
Copy link
Contributor Author

Not tested, just inspiration for mooltipass/mooltipass-udev#3 (comment)

@limpkin limpkin marked this pull request as ready for review November 30, 2022 09:18
@limpkin
Copy link
Collaborator

limpkin commented Nov 30, 2022

I'm OK to merge this as it is... simply give me the go ahead :)

@bobsaintcool
Copy link
Contributor Author

Thanks, i'll wait until the weekend hopefully @PoroCYon can provide feedback as I don't have the environment to test

@PoroCYon
Copy link

PoroCYon commented Dec 1, 2022

It looks fine to me, though I'd change the wording/fix the spelling a bit:

Note: For Linux systems without systemd (eg. Gentoo, Void Linux), please refer to [this section](#non-systemd-linux).
##### Linux without systemd

The main [udev rules](https://aur.archlinux.org/packages/mooltipass-udev/)
rely on integration between systemd, systemd-login and systemd-udevd
to automatically allow any user logged in to access mooltipass devices.
This will not works on devices without systemd, one
workaround is to change the `TAG+="uaccess"` to
`GROUP="plugdev"` and add your interactive user to this group.

See [this issue](https://github.com/mooltipass/mooltipass-udev/pull/3) for more information and a possible patch.

(I wouldn't refer to my packages here, as those are specific to Void Linux, and also don't yet exist fully.)

@bobsaintcool
Copy link
Contributor Author

Thanks for you review.

@limpkin I believe we are good to go on my side

@limpkin
Copy link
Collaborator

limpkin commented Dec 2, 2022

thanks everyone :)

@limpkin limpkin merged commit 5c8e675 into mooltipass:master Dec 2, 2022
@bobsaintcool bobsaintcool deleted the feature/bob/udev_void branch December 3, 2022 23:53
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ants